“Hong Hua is in an interesting position, in which it targets a luxury experience and great eats. The environment certainly meets those expectations as it feels more like a higher end, business focused feel with the refinement, yet everyone seems to be in street casual mode. Also food is offered in a a’la cart style very similar to a higher end steak house; you bill can scale up quickly because of this.
Food: The menu certainly has specialized dishes you won’t find in the average Chinese restaurant. Peking Duck is one of those things you should certainly try; it’s an broasted duck served with a unique pancake & sauces. I’ve been going here off and on for the past 10 years and they seem consistent. IMHO I feel leans toward the western taste, meaning heightened emphasis on certain spices such as salt. I’ve had the opportunity to sample authentic Chinese foods in China & other Asian countries. In terms of authenticity I give them an A-; it’s tasty
Price: Seems to be on the higher end; from 1-10…I’d say level 7 or 8.“

“I’ve been here a few times as it’s consistently tasty each time. While the menu focuses on noodle variations it offers other tasty treats. Watching the noodles crafted by hand is quite entertaining. It’s made in a similar way that pizza is made, instead of spinning dough into a saucer, here they perform fancy jump rope techniques into thin tasty noodles cooked in seconds. Adorned with various proteins, veggies, & spice levels there’s bound to be something you like. I find these flavors to border the authentic side vs. Panda express. Aside from the great eats I like the fact that there’s a ev charger in the parking lot (not free though).“
